Analogue Travelogue is my personal journey through the things that interest me the most; travel, film photography, and documentary film making.

Analogue Travelogue is my journal.

Analogue Travelogue my creative outlet, a portfolio of ideas, and a public record of my exploration of this world.

To begin with, Analogue Travelogue will follow my attempt, with my girlfriend, to hike the Te Araroa (“The Long Pathway”) – a through-hike spanning the length of New Zealand; from Cape Reinga at the northern tip of the North island, to Bluff at the southern tip of the South Island. This will be my “travelogue” – my stream-of-conciousness account of the adventure to traverse an entire country.

I’m a passionate film (analogue) photography enthusiast, and amateur film-maker, and so with this in mind I have committed to carrying many kilos of film photography and digital-film-making equipment, to document this adventure in the best way I know how.
